Key Takeaways

- Diagnose before you fix: 80% of DIY failures come from treating symptoms (a wet wall) instead of the root cause (a leaking pipe joint or condensation from poor ventilation). Always check the source first.
- Know the “normal” range: A small crack in drywall from settling is normal; a crack wider than 1/8 inch or one that reappears after patching signals foundation movement — call a structural engineer.
- Use the 5-Why method: Ask “why” five times to trace a problem to its source. Example: Why is the paint peeling? Moisture behind the wall. Why moisture? Leaky pipe. Why leaky? Loose fitting. Fix: tighten the fitting, not just repaint.
- Water and mold are non-negotiable: If you see mold or persistent dampness, stop DIY immediately. Mold remediation requires containment and professional-grade equipment — improper handling spreads spores and creates bigger health risks.
- Safety first, always: Any problem involving gas lines, live electrical panels, or structural load-bearing walls is not a DIY job. The cost of a professional is cheaper than a hospital visit or a collapsed ceiling.

Home improvement troubleshooting is the systematic process of separating a surface-level symptom from its root cause before you touch a single tool. A dripping faucet (symptom) almost always points to a worn washer or O-ring, not a burst pipe. A flickering light (symptom) usually means a loose connection or a failing switch, not a dead circuit. If you treat symptoms, you’ll fix nothing — and often break more.

The 48-Hour Mold Rule (Backed by the EPA)
The U.S. Environmental Protection Agency (EPA) is blunt: mold can begin growing within 24 to 48 hours after a material gets wet. This is your most critical decision rule in water-related troubleshooting.
Here’s the protocol I use on every job:
- Find and stop the water source (a leaky pipe joint, a flashing gap, a cracked seal).
- Dry the area thoroughly—use fans, dehumidifiers, and open windows. Aim for a moisture reading below 15% on wood or drywall.
- Set a timer for 48 hours. If the area is still damp or discolored after that window, assume mold is present.
At that point, a DIY mold test kit (around $10–$20 at any hardware store) can confirm your suspicion. But here’s the trade-off: if the wet area is larger than 10 square feet, the EPA recommends hiring a professional mold remediator. Why? Disturbing a large mold colony without proper containment can spread spores throughout your HVAC system, turning a $500 fix into a $5,000 disaster.

Electrical Symptoms: When to Panic (and When Not To)
Flickering lights are common when your AC compressor kicks on or your refrigerator cycles. That’s a normal voltage dip. But here’s the edge case most guides miss: if the light flickers and the switch plate feels warm to the touch, you have a problem.
Warm switch plates indicate a loose wire connection or an overloaded circuit. This is not a DIY fix. Loose connections generate heat, which can melt wire insulation and start a fire inside your wall. The National Fire Protection Association reports that electrical failures or malfunctions cause roughly 44,000 home fires each year. A warm plate is a sign that demands a licensed electrician—not a YouTube tutorial.
The Recurrence Checklist: Your Go/No-Go Decision Tool
Before you pick up a tool, ask yourself one question: Is this a one-time fix or a recurring symptom?
- One-time fix: Replacing a worn-out toilet flapper, patching a nail hole, tightening a loose cabinet hinge. DIY these with confidence.
- Recurring symptom: Your sink clogs every three months. Your basement floods after every heavy rain. Your lights flicker even when no large appliances are running. These are not bad luck—they are signs of a deeper systemic problem.
Take recurring clogs. A plunger or a bottle of drain cleaner might clear the pipe today, but if the issue returns, you likely have tree roots invading your sewer line or a collapsed pipe underground. A DIY snake won’t fix that. You need a camera inspection and likely a professional excavation. Ignoring the recurrence pattern turns a $300 repair into a $3,000 full replacement.

Step 1: Isolate the Problem — Shut Off the Right Thing
Before you touch anything, kill the power or water supply to the specific area you’re working on. For water, that means turning off the angle stop under the sink — not the main house valve — unless you’re sure the leak is in a wall. For electrical, flip the breaker for that circuit, not the main panel. A common mistake: shutting off the main water valve when a single supply line is the issue, which drains your entire system and wastes 30 minutes refilling air pockets.
Step 2: Identify the Symptom and Trace It to a Cause
Don’t treat the symptom — treat the root. If you have low water pressure, ask: is it one faucet or every faucet? If it’s just the kitchen sink, the likely culprit is a clogged aerator (the screen at the tip). If it’s the whole house, you’re looking at pipe corrosion, a pressure regulator issue, or a municipal supply problem. Here’s the decision rule: one fixture = local blockage; all fixtures = system-wide problem. That simple split saves hours of unnecessary pipe disassembly.
Step 3: Test the Simplest Fix First
This is the golden rule of home improvement troubleshooting common problems: the easy fix works 80% of the time. For low water pressure, unscrew the aerator (hand-tighten counterclockwise), rinse it under running water, and scrub any debris with an old toothbrush. Reinstall and test. That’s it — no tools required, zero cost, and it resolves the vast majority of single-faucet pressure drops. If that doesn’t work, then move to checking the supply line for kinks or mineral buildup.
For mold after a water leak: the clock starts ticking. You have 24 hours to dry the affected area using fans and a dehumidifier. After that, scrub the surface with a detergent solution — not bleach. The EPA explicitly warns that bleach only masks surface mold and does not kill it on porous materials like drywall or wood. If the moldy area exceeds 10 square feet (roughly the size of a standard bath towel), stop. Do not attempt to clean it yourself. Consult an EPA-recommended remediation specialist to avoid airborne spore spread that can contaminate your entire HVAC system.
Budget Troubleshooting: The 20/2 Rule
Here’s a data point the top search results ignore: always add a 20% contingency to material costs and double your estimated time. If you think a faucet replacement will cost $50 and take 2 hours, budget $60 and 4 hours. Why? Because every DIY project hits at least one unexpected snag — a corroded nut that won’t budge, a missing part, or a trip to the hardware store mid-project. Rushing because you’re out of time or money leads to safety oversights: improper ladder angles, skipping eye protection, or wiring mistakes that cause electrical shocks. The 20/2 rule prevents that.
When to Call a Pro (Non-Negotiable Boundaries)
Some lines you do not cross as a DIYer. Call a licensed professional if the repair involves:
- Gas lines — a gas leak is an explosion risk.
- Main electrical panels — even with the main breaker off, exposed bus bars carry lethal voltage.
- Load-bearing walls — removing the wrong stud can collapse your ceiling.
- Unexpected water damage or mold — if you open a wall and find standing water or visible mold growth, stop. That’s a sign of a hidden leak that requires professional drying equipment and possibly structural repair.

Contemplating coverage?
If you’re contemplating coverage for home repairs, consider a home warranty for major systems (HVAC, plumbing, electrical) and homeowners insurance for sudden damage like a burst pipe. Warranty covers wear-and-tear breakdowns; insurance covers accidents. Read the fine print — most policies exclude pre-existing conditions and improper DIY repairs.
